The Evolution of the Norwegian Driving Licence
Norway, while not a member of the European Union, is deeply integrated into the European Economic Area (EEA). As a result, Norwegian driving licences conform to European Union standards relating to design, categories, and lorry classifications.
For many years, the physical design of the licence has actually transformed significantly. Older paper-based brochures and older plastic cards have actually been phased out in favor of the contemporary, credit-card-sized polycarbonate format. This shift was driven by the requirement to fight sophisticated forgery methods and line up with pan-European anti-fraud initiatives.

Counterfeiters have grown increasingly knowledgeable, but contemporary card production innovations outmatch them by utilizing products and printing methods that are exceptionally tough to reproduce.
1. Polycarbonate Substrate
Unlike standard PVC cards utilized in commitment programs or older IDs, genuine Norwegian driving licences are made of multilayered polycarbonate. When tapped against a hard surface area, a polycarbonate card produces a distinct metallic noise and is stiff, extremely resilient, and nearly impossible to delaminate without ruining the card completely.
2. Laser Engraving
All individual information, including the photo, signature, and biographical details, are not printed with ink. Instead, they are laser-engraved into the inner layers of the polycarbonate.
- Tactile Effect: Running a finger over the card will reveal that the text and the holder's picture have a distinct, raised or recessed tactile feel.
- Monochrome Imagery: The main portrait on an authentic card is rendered in black and white (grayscale), produced by carbon particles reacting to the laser underneath the surface area layer.
3. Optically Variable Devices (OVD) and Holograms
A genuine card includes complex optical aspects that move color and reveal concealed graphics when tilted under a light.
- Kinesigram/ Hologram: A diffractive optically variable image gadget is embedded on the front of the card, often showing kinetic movements, moving colors, or micro-text that alters depending on the seeing angle.
4. Ultraviolet (UV) and Infrared (IR) Features
Under UV light, a genuine Norwegian driving licence springs to life with fluorescent security components.
- UV-Reactive Printing: Specialized inks radiance in unique colors (usually neon green, blue, or yellow) under UVA and UVB light. These components typically consist of complicated background guilloche patterns, the national flag, or particular regulatory symbols that are completely undetectable under normal daytime.

Finest Practices for Verifying a Licence:
- The Tilt Test: Always move the card under a light source to examine the holographic aspects and OVD behavior.
- The Touch Test: Feel the surface area. Smooth, ink-printed cards or pixelated pictures are instant red flags.
- The Magnification Test: Use a jeweler's loupe to check micro-text. On a genuine card, lines that appear to the naked eye as strong borders are really composed of tiny, completely understandable text (e.g., "NORGE" or "STATENS VEGVESEN").
- Technological Aids: Utilize UV light checkers or electronic document scanners where high-volume confirmation is needed.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Are older paper Norwegian driving licences still legitimate?
No. All older paper and non-polycarbonate plastic driving licences have actually been phased out. Every valid Norwegian driving licence should now adhere to the contemporary EEA credit-card format. If somebody provides a paper licence, it is either void or a novelty item.

4. How can I check if a driving licence has been revoked?
Private people and companies can not straight search the live database of the Norwegian Public Roads Administration due to strict privacy regulations (GDPR). However, the status of a motorist can often be confirmed through official channels if there is a legal basis, or by asking for complementary recognition documents that validate the person's present standing.
